Output d5baf35742fe3afafc136ef6811bdbb16c08d11cf8826f92e361bc721b973e6c:42

value
82565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89a686058e352818a8d805adc7fb628fe051afdc OP_EQUALVERIFY OP_CHECKSIG
address
1DYq4YCcaukXiYsMpdJcUQtnd5B7P84TCS
transaction
d5baf35742fe3afafc136ef6811bdbb16c08d11cf8826f92e361bc721b973e6c
spent
true